Important Notice
Wiring and connection must be carried out by a
registered electrician.
Connection by an unqualified person voids the
warranty.
Please check the suitability of the motor before
attempting to connect it to the device.
Ensure the motor terminals are configured to
suit supply from VSD,
for 1ph supply VFD the
motor must be connected in DELTA. For 3ph
supply VFD please consult the motors name tag
for 400V connection.

1.Status Display –Display the drives current status
2.LED Display—Indicates frequency, voltage, current, user
defined units
3.Potentiometer—For local frequency setting
4.Run Key— to start drive locally
5.UP & DOWN Key—Used to change numerical numbers,
frequency, parameters
6.Mode—Change between different display mode
7.STOP/RESET— Stops AC drive operation and resets the drive
after a fault has occurred
8.ENTER—Used to enter and save the parameters

Quick Setup for Variable Speed Drive
Turn on power to unit and follow as below:
Display will show ether F, H, A, U after power up.
Press the enter button.
00. will appear on the screen, this is the parameter group.
Use the up and down keys to change parameter group to the
desired one. Press "ENTER".
00.00 will appear on the screen, this is the sub group.
Use the up and down keys to change parameters selections to
the desired one. Press "ENTER"
You will now be able to change the required setting of the pa-
rameter to the desired value or setting. Press "ENTER". End

will flash on your screen to indicate that your setting has been
saved.
Continue the above steps till all of your required parameters
have been set.
If you need to back out of a sub parameter group you can press

the "MODE" button.
Once all the parameters have been set press the "MODE"
button till the F50.0 screen comes up again.

List of quick set up parameters
00.02 All parameters are reset to factory settings or 50Hz
settings, set to 9 (must be none after initial powerup)
00.20 Source of master Frequency Command.
0 = UP/DOWN arrow (Factory setting)
2 = External analog input
3 = External UP/DOWN terminals
7 = Digital keypad potentiometer
00.21 Source of master Operation Command.
0 = Digital keypad (Factory setting )
1 = External terminals
01.00 Change to the maximum Frequency required
01.01 Change value to match Hz on motor nameplate
01.02 Change to match voltage on motor nameplate (Max
Voltage output)
01.10 Upper limit Frequency
01.11 Lower limit Frequency
01.12 Acceleration time (factory setting 10sec)
01.13 Deceleration time (factory setting 10sec)
05.01 Set to Motor Name Plate Current
05.02 Set to Motor Name Plate kW
05.03 Set to Motor Name Plate Speed (rpm)
05.04 Set as the number of poles of the motor
(3000rpm=2pole; 1500rpm=4pole;1000rpm=6pole;
750rpm=8pole) (factory setting 4 pole)
05.00 Auto tuning, option 1 Dynamic test for induction
motor = 1 (note motor must be unloaded), Static test for
induction motor = 2, after the parameter number is
entered press "MODE" button to return to main screen
showing "F30.00 or F33.33", press the "RUN" button to
start auto tune, Auto tuning should only be preformed
after all the data is entered.
06.13 Electronic thermal relay.
0 = Inverter motor (with external forced cooling fitted)
1 = Standard motor (motor with fan on shaft)
2 = Disable (factory setting)
